Safety Precautions: Prioritizing Safety Features
Safety should always take precedence when purchasing a bounce house. Look for products that meet safety standards and certifications. Features like reinforced stitching, robust materials, and safety nets are crucial to prevent accidents and create a secure playing environment.
Finding the Right Fit: Size Matters
Consider the bounce house’s size concerning the available space and the age group of intended users. Smaller models suit younger children, while larger ones with multiple sections and features cater to older kids or accommodate more users at once.
Material Quality: Durability for Longevity
Durability is key for prolonged enjoyment of the bounce house. Opt for high-quality materials such as PVC vinyl known for their resistance against tears and punctures, ensuring prolonged use without compromising safety or structural integrity.

Air Blowers and Setup: Ensuring Continuous Inflation
The air blower serves as the heartbeat of a bounce house, continuously supplying air to keep it inflated. Prioritize a high-quality blower to avoid any potential malfunctions. Additionally, consider ease of setup and storage convenience for practical use.

Maintenance Guidelines: Securing Longevity
Regular maintenance is essential to preserve the bounce house’s lifespan. Adhere to manufacturer guidelines for cleaning and storage. Conduct thorough inspections before and after each use to identify and address any potential damages promptly.
